Output d0c53f13f777961a6124d50e21a3942994e30d462fecf568604000c3b60769b9:4

value
23603271
script pubkey
OP_0 OP_PUSHBYTES_20 ec4cd50a0eb2118ec575519903b74af91fd2db80
address
bc1qa3xd2zswkggca3t42xvs8d62ly0a9kuqwpvwt5
transaction
d0c53f13f777961a6124d50e21a3942994e30d462fecf568604000c3b60769b9
spent
true